This is in contrast to :meth:`Task.close`, which does the first two steps, but does not terminate the running Python process.
For example, in
```
.. code-block:: py
task.mark_completed()
from time import sleep
sleep(30)
print('This text will not be printed!')
```
the text will not be printed, because the Python process is immediately terminated.

Enables you to manually shut down the task.
This method does not terminate the current Python process, in contrast to :meth:`Task.mark_completed`.
After having :meth:`Task.close`d a task, the respective object cannot be used anymore and
